fapchat
@fapchat

Почему не работает onclick или querySelector?

for (let variable of querySelectorAll('.figure')) {
  variable.onclick = function(){
  querySelector('.figure .figure__hover-content').style.opacity = '1';
  };
}


Нужно, чтобы, когда я кликаю на картинку, она становилась непрозрачной и заменяла бэкраунд?Вот так работает
.figure:hover .figure__hover-content {
    opacity: 1;
  }

  • Вопрос задан
  • 355 просмотров
Решения вопроса 1
Jukk
@Jukk
for (let variable of document.querySelectorAll('.figure')) {
variable.onclick = function(){
this.querySelector('.figure .figure__hover-content').style.opacity = '1';
};
}
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ы